Today we air a special episode of 1010 Thrive – the second in a five-part series about a man who remembered to give thanks. Ephraim, a Samaritan from the city of Sychar, is forced to leave his hometown when he is diagnosed with leprosy. In today’s episode he meets up with a company of Jewish lepers in Judea. They welcome him into their midst.
We also pause to do a Tuesday Top Ten List: Ten Notes on Leprosy.
In this five-part series, we learn that God values the least. He honors faith. He cherishes gratitude. How do we give thanks and keep an attitude of gratitude in our everyday lives?
Scriptures referenced include Leviticus 13; Luke 17:1-19; and Matthew 8:1-4.
